call me a noob but how does these fantasy games work? A lot of people I know are really into these games but I keep forgeting to ask them how they work.

Corbitt
04-18-2004, 08:42 AM
Well, in alot of them, there is a draft where each person recruits a player from the nfl until each person has enough positions filled. There are still lots of players left, so you can trade or pick them up later on in the season if one of ur player's gets hurt or performs poorly. Then, you go up against another team in ur league each week, and whoever gets the most points...wins. You get points how on well your players perform...yards, td's, sacks, blah blah. There are other ways to play fantasy sports, but this is the way I played last season. You can also play where you have a certain amount of money to spend and you have to buy all ur players. The more popular players are worth more, but different teams in your league can have the same player.

I have been in a Yahoo league for the past 4 years. They are pretty good, if you don't like the options. For example, you have to wait until Tuesday morning to check your scores. If you want the StatTracker, which is their live scoring program, you have to pay $9.99 per person in your league. There are many sites out there that cost about the same and include all of this. So, if you're a casual player then I'd go with Yahoo.
